To further support the vitality of the Gainsborough town centre and the other town centre place making programmes, the Council is launching a grant scheme which will incentivise freeholders/ long leaseholders to create or reinstate residential dwellings within the town centre.  Presence of residential uses within town centres is important to its vitality and vibrancy, as it increases the footfall within the town centre, especially outside of core shopping hours.

West Lindsey District Council Levelling-Up Fund is providing grants for the scheme, leading to the creation residential dwellings within the following Town Centre locations:

  • Lord Street
  • Market Place
  • Market Street
  • North Street
  • Silver Street
